
Iran has threatened to reveal “new cards” if the cease-fire isn’t extended and conflict restarts, while President Trump warned “lots of bombs” will start going off if there’s no peace deal.
Mohammed-Bagher Ghalibaf, the Islamic Republic’s parliamentary speaker, said Monday the country has “prepared” during the truce – before lashing out at Trump, who renewed his threat to blitz Iranian infrastructure if talks are unsuccessful.
“Trump, by imposing a siege and violating the ceasefire, seeks to turn this negotiating table— in his own imagination— into a table of surrender or to justify renewed warmongering,” Ghalibaf, who spearheaded the Iranian delegation in Islamabad last week, wrote on X.
“We do not accept negotiations under the shadow of threats, and in the past two weeks, we have prepared to reveal new cards on the battlefield.”
